0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

USB Type-C PD中的快速角色交换将推动新的用户体验

安森美 来源:杨湘祁 作者:电子发烧友 2019-03-12 17:08 次阅读

我们生活在一个不断变化的时代,人们普遍一致地感觉到的是进步而不是混乱。新兴技术可能确实具有颠覆性,包括5G人工智能,因此很容易理解它们为什么会受到大量关注。当它们各自单独发展时,它们可能会被认为不着边际。然而,对于那些更贴近的发展,很明显,它们将促成下一代应用领域,如自动驾驶和一个更智能物联网(IoT)。与此同时,在熟悉的领域也在发生其他重大变化,包括更成熟的技术。其中包括USB

Type-C接口代表USB的一个显著进步,因为它提供比前代接口多得多的功能。为了支持这一愿景,USB Implementers Forum(USB-IF)负责监管新功能和特性的开发,这些功能和特性有可能从根本上改变我们的连接方式。最初USB作为一种支持和扩展PC功能的技术被推出时,在消费领域和其他领域都产生了巨大的影响。在成为连接外设与计算机的默认方法的同时,也为开发人员提供方便的调试接口。很快它就像其名字所示那样具有普遍性。当考虑到我们使用有线通信的方式时,USBType-C接口带来了可与5G相当的颠覆性因素。其中一个重要的因素是设备能够同时供电和被供电,并在这两种模式之间进行切换,而不需要用户的任何介入,这是有线总线所特有的。正是这种能力将有助于推动一种新的设备的推出,即独立的USB扩展坞(Dock)。

01

Dock的演进

USB集线器并非新的概念。主机一直能够计算比通过物理端口实际支持的更多设备,因此具有多个USB端口的集线器成为主机扩展物理USB端口数的简单方法。在这种情况下,控制总是属于主机设备,通常是一台PC,电源也一样。

在USB Type-C规范下,主机和设备的定义更为灵活,采用双角色端口(DRP)模式,支持设备在下行端口(DFP)和上行端口(UFP)之间切换。电源也更灵活,使设备能够动态地提供和接收电力。这超越了USBOn-The-Go (OTG)的概念,尽管可以公平地说,USB OTG在将USB生态系统从桌面扩展到我们的口袋中起了很大的作用。

USB Type-C的一个主要特点是电力传输(PD)。正是这种协议支持任何设备成为电源或被供电,同时不依赖数据流。

例如,外部供电的集线器,可为笔记本电脑充电,同时连接到投影仪或显示器。在这种情况下,笔记本电脑是一个电源接收器和一个数据源。总之,集线器成为网络中心,虽然这有许多益处,但也带来某些负担。

比起所有设备都是集线器,人们更期望出现一类新的集线器 USB Dock;它支持多个USB Type-C端口和旧的USB端口。为了在电力传输方面在这些端口之间进行协商决议,Dock将需要支持专门为这一新模式开发的特性。

02

快速角色交换

除了DRP之外,支持新的Type-C模式的一个关键技术是快速角色交换(FRS),它有效地确保需要电源的设备始终可以获得电源。实际上,在事件标准序列中,每当电源从扩展坞分离,这都会发生。FRS是一种加速电源角色交换序列的方法,这样数据就不会被中断(因此用户体验也不会中断)。实际上,如果电源从扩展坞移除,附加在其上的外设不应受到影响。

该过程是通过使用Type-C连接器上的CC引脚来控制和初始化的。如果电源从扩展坞上移除,它将通过驱动CC引脚到接地电位来向它当前正在供电的设备发出信号。此时,FRS信令覆盖CC端口上的任何活动,排队等待传输的消息将被删除。当接收设备响应FR_Swap消息时,就完成了握手协议;图1的流程图说明了FRS流程。

【图1:快速角色交换流程图】

图片说明

0:集线器由TA供电,并为设备供电

1:壁式适配器断开连接

2:集线器接收电源设备通过VBUS_SINK_DISC检测到断开连接,并将GPO2输出拉低

3:集线器初始化电源设备检测GPI2 输入上的低传输和停止供电

4:集线器初始化电源设备用ITCPCSendFRSwap向设备的初始化接收电力设备发出FR_Swap信号

5:设备的初始化接收电力设备收到FR_Swap信号,停止接收电力并开始为VBUS供电

该规范要求在150 µs或更短的时间内实现,因此需要一些额外的技术。通常,支持FRS的集线器将有多个Type-C端口可用,每个端口都有自己关联的Type-C端口控制器(包括电源传输(PD))。为了协调所有端口,PD控制器需要协同工作,这可通过使用一个Type-C端口管理器(TCPM)或为PD3.0设计的具有双角色端口和支持FRS的PD控制器来实现,例如安森美半导体的FUSB307B。

以一种持久的方式实现FRS需要考虑许多场景,例如如果扩展坞的主电源突然被移除会发生什么。这将影响到扩展坞上的所有设备,包括TCPM。

【图2:使用FUSB307B的笔记本应用示例】

快速角色交换是一种支持技术,它将推动USB Dock的开发,以提供一种新的用户体验。USB生态系统正在迅速发展,在更广泛的设备中采用USB Type-C将促进这一技术变革。通过采用支持双角色端口和快速角色交换的PD控制器,原始设备制造商(OEM)将更好地利用这一新机会。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• usb
    usb
    +关注

    关注

    59

    文章

    7436

    浏览量

    258217
  • type-c
    +关注

    关注

    545

    文章

    1550

    浏览量

    266400

原文标题:USB Type-C PD中的快速角色交换将推动新的用户体验

文章出处:【微信号:onsemi-china,微信公众号:安森美】欢迎添加关注!文章转载请注明出处。

收藏 人收藏

    评论

    相关推荐

    Type-C 双向快充管理PD芯片CH227

    Type-C 双向快充管理PD芯片CH227 CH227 单芯片集成 USB PD 协议,是用于 Type-C 接口
    的头像 发表于 04-14 17:05 334次阅读
    <b class='flag-5'>Type-C</b> 双向快充管理<b class='flag-5'>PD</b>芯片CH227

    带集成电源的双端口USB Type-C®和USB PD控制器TPS65988DK数据表

    电子发烧友网站提供《带集成电源的双端口USB Type-C®和USB PD控制器TPS65988DK数据表.pdf》资料免费下载
    发表于 03-05 10:29 0次下载
    带集成电源的双端口<b class='flag-5'>USB</b> <b class='flag-5'>Type-C</b>®和<b class='flag-5'>USB</b> <b class='flag-5'>PD</b>控制器TPS65988DK数据表

    使用MUX连接USB Type-C接口时,CYUSB3014的C9引脚应该连到哪里?

    在参考了KBA218460的设计后,我发现3014的C9引脚(QTG_ID)并没有标注应该和MUX或USB Type-C的哪一个引脚相连。 请问在使用MUX连接USB
    发表于 02-29 07:47

    USBTYPE-C串口的原理和使用

    USB不仅可以传输数据,也可以对设备进行充电,请问充电该走哪条线路,尤其是现在手机数据线快充的条件下,功率能够达到很大? 3、TYPE-C口可以说是USB的升级版本,相较于USB
    发表于 01-27 16:16

    USB电力传输(USB PD)和USB Type-C的不同之处是什么?

    USB电力传输(USB PD)和USB Type-C的不同之处是什么? USB
    的头像 发表于 10-27 14:31 1604次阅读

    什么是PD充电?PD充电与Type-c有什么关系呢?

    充电与Type-c有什么关系呢?本文将为您详尽、详实、细致地讲解相关内容。 一、什么是PD充电? PD全称为Power Delivery,中文意为功率传送。PD充电是通过
    的头像 发表于 10-27 14:31 8083次阅读

    USB-C/Type-C取电诱骗PD快充5V9V12V20V方法

    随着USB-C/Type-C接口的普及,日常生活中到处可以看到使用支持USB-C/Type-C接口的电子产品,如手机,笔记本电脑,平板电脑、筋膜枪,智能家居、小风扇,台灯产品等等,想要
    的头像 发表于 09-15 16:08 2322次阅读
    <b class='flag-5'>USB</b>-C/<b class='flag-5'>Type-C</b>取电诱骗<b class='flag-5'>PD</b>快充5V9V12V20V方法

    type-cUSB-c有什么区别 type-cUSB-c接口原理

    ,从功能角度来看,Type-CUSB-C 没有区别,它们都支持高速数据传输、充电和视频输出等功能。然而,需要注意,不是所有 Type-C 接口都支持 USB 3.1、
    的头像 发表于 09-01 16:50 2.4w次阅读

    Kinetic KTM5000 TYPE-C Hub方案,支持多屏MST/SST,带PD供电,type-c输入3*DP输出

    普及化,而Type-C的DP Alt Mode三大功能,分别是DP传输、PD供电以及USB传输,将其应用在外设拓展输入接口,不仅能正常传输视频和数据信号,还能解决设备供电问题。 2
    发表于 08-16 09:24

    USB通讯和PD电源双功能Type-C接口MCU-CH32X035

    USB PDType-C控制器及PHY 快速GPIO端口,支持24个外部中断 96位芯片唯一ID 串行2线调试接口SDI 封装形式:LQFP64M、LQFP48、QFN28、QSO
    发表于 08-09 11:19

    用于Type-C接口USB通讯的同时进行充放电的双向快充管理芯片CH227

    CH227 单芯片集成 USB PD 协议,是用于 Type-C 接口 USB 通讯的同时进行充放电的双向快充管理芯片。支持数据角色和电源
    的头像 发表于 07-18 10:13 1996次阅读
    用于<b class='flag-5'>Type-C</b>接口<b class='flag-5'>USB</b>通讯的同时进行充放电的双向快充管理芯片CH227

    USB Type-C PD取电芯片LDR6328S介绍

    LDR6328S是一款兼容 USB PD、QC 和 AFC 协议的USB Type-C PD取电(诱骗,诱电,SINK)芯片,从支持
    的头像 发表于 07-15 09:52 738次阅读
    <b class='flag-5'>USB</b> <b class='flag-5'>Type-C</b> <b class='flag-5'>PD</b>取电芯片LDR6328S介绍

    筋膜枪专用取电芯片,USB Type-C PD取电(诱骗,诱电,SINK)芯片

    扇,台灯等这样的用电器,想要支持Type-c PD的快充功能,就需要内置一颗USB Type-C PD取电(诱骗,诱电,SINK)芯片。 L
    的头像 发表于 07-04 18:18 630次阅读
    筋膜枪专用取电芯片,<b class='flag-5'>USB</b> <b class='flag-5'>Type-C</b> <b class='flag-5'>PD</b>取电(诱骗,诱电,SINK)芯片

    USB Type-C连接器的快速充电和数据传输功能

    的功率输出,从而使设备能够更快速地充电,节省用户的时间。 1.3 智能功率管理:USB Type-C连接器支持智能功率管理,可以
    的头像 发表于 06-21 09:45 1332次阅读
    <b class='flag-5'>USB</b> <b class='flag-5'>Type-C</b>连接器的<b class='flag-5'>快速</b>充电和数据传输功能

    现代半导体推出高集成双端口USB Type-c PD微控制器

      为了提高快速充电方案,现代半导体推出了高集成双端口USB Type-c PD微控制器(MCU)A94P829. 新产品可 DRP(Dual Role Port)应用Power Ba
    的头像 发表于 06-16 10:31 1303次阅读